Scope

The Terrell Creek Trunk Sewer project consisted of upsizing a major trunk sewer system within the City of Atlanta, utilizing a combination of conventional open-cut, pipe-bursting, and jack and bore installation methods. Work included bypass pumping, pre and post CCTV inspection, and the rehabilitation, replacement, and installation of sewer manholes throughout the project limits. Ruby-Collins completed 10,274 LF of 36-inch pipe, 395 LF of 48-inch jack and bore, installation of 59 precast concrete manholes, and grout fill abandonment of the existing sewer.

Unique Challenges

This project required bypassing, rock removal, and creek crossings
